苹果线上签名,也被称为苹果开发者签名,是一种将应用程序打包并与开发者的数字签名绑定的过程。这个过程可以让用户在安装应用程序时信任开发者,以便他们可以在没有越狱的情况下安装应用程序。
苹果线上签名的原理是将应用程序打包成一个.ipa文件,然后使用开发者证书对该文件进行签名。开发者证书可以通过苹果开发者账户获得,这个账户需要开发者支付一定的费用。签名后的应用程序可以在苹果设备上安装和运行,因为这些设备已经信任了苹果公司,因此也信任了由其签名的应用程序。
苹果线上签名的好处是可以让开发者轻松地将应用程序部署到用户设备上,而不需要用户进行复杂的设置或安装过程。此外,苹果线上签名还可以帮助开发者保护他们的应用程序免受恶意攻击,因为只有经过签名的应用程序才能在用户设备上运行。
苹果线上签名的过程如下:
1. 获取开发者账户和证书:开发者需要注册苹果开发者账户,并获得开发者证书。
2. 创建应用程序:开发者使用Xcode或其他开发工具创建应用程序。
3. 打包应用程序:开发者将应用程序打包成.ipa文件。
4. 签名应用程序:开发者使用开发者证书对应用程序进行签名。
5. 分发应用程序:开发者可以将签名的应用程序通过App Store或其他渠道分发给用户。
总之,苹果线上签名是一种很有用的技术,它可以帮助开发者将应用程序快速部署到用户设备上,同时也可以保护应用程序免受恶意攻击。如果您是一名iOS开发者,那么了解苹果线上签名的原理和过程,将有助于您更好地开发和分发应用程序。